MMGB: Apple 'A little company'

Watch the film conceptualised by the in-house team at Apple here

Apple's ad for the new Group FaceTime function unites Elvis Presley impersonators from around the world.
 
Set to the Elvis ballad There’s Always Me, the film shows each impersonator delivering their own twist on the song and representing different eras. Just as Elvis’ music is able to connect lonely hearts everywhere, Group FaceTime can bring people closer.
